Overview

1000 Introductory Toxicology Review Questions is the perfect study companion for undergraduate and graduate students taking their first course in general toxicology. Learn painlessly by reviewing multiple choice and short answer questions that cover basic principles as well as new thinking in all major areas.

Author Information

Dr. Richard Fruncillo spent most of his professional career as a clinical pharmacologist/human toxicologist conducting phase 1 clinical research studies for a major US pharmaceutical corporation. In addition to being an internal medicine physician, he has an undergraduate degree in chemistry from the University of Pennsylvania, and a Ph.D in biochemical pharmacology from Drexel University College of Medicine. He is cert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ine, the American Board of Clinical Pharmacology, and the American Board of Toxicology. He has previously taught pharmacology/toxicology at the medical/graduate school level, and is the author of many scientific publications in the areas of basic and clinical pharmacology/toxicology. Currently he is a consultant to the medical and legal professions in the areas of pharmacology, toxicology, and drug development.
